Загрузочная загрузка r проблема после r установка Ubuntu 20.04 на USB-накопитель Fla sh на MacBook Pro с Bootcamp - proUbuntu
0 голосов
/ 19 июля 2020

У меня есть MacBook Pro (середина 2015 г.), на котором я установил систему с двойной загрузкой с MacOS и Windows 10, которые я успешно использую в течение r более r 3 лет. В то время я собирался попробовать тройную загрузку с Ubuntu 16.04, но у меня закончилось место на моем разделе Windows (Bootcamp), куда я собирался установить Ubuntu. После того, как r прочитал количество r статей, я решил установить Ubuntu на USB-накопитель Fla sh, следуя ценным инструкциям Тима Ричардсона, чтобы снять флажки загрузки EFI и esp с моего внутреннего накопителя, чтобы installe r мог видеть и загружать EFI только на мой USB-накопитель fla sh. Похоже, это сработало! У меня есть USB-накопитель Fla sh, который я могу подключить к старому MacBook Pro (2008) и вызвать Ubuntu 20.04, но он сильно испортил загрузочную загрузку r на моем MacBook Pro (середина 2015 года), которая Хотел тройную загрузку с. Вот снимки до и после r моей системы:

До

Ricks-MacBook-Pro:~ rickmaxxx$ di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*251.0 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k1         165.0 GB   disk0s2
   3:       Microsoft Basic Data BOOTCAMP                84.9 GB    disk0s3
   4:           Windows Recovery                         897.6 MB   disk0s4

/dev/disk1 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+165.0 GB   disk1
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            88.3 GB    disk1s1
   2:                APFS Volume Preboot                 46.6 MB    disk1s2
   3:                APFS Volume Recovery                510.5 MB   disk1s3
   4:                APFS Volume VM                      1.1 GB     disk1s4

Ricks-MacBook-Pro:~ rickmaxxx$ sudo gpt -r show /dev/disk0
Password:
      start       size  index  contents
          0          1         PMBR
          1          1         Pri GPT header
          2         32         Pri GPT table
         34          6         
         40     409600      1  GPT part - C12A7328-F81F-11D2-BA4B-00A0C93EC93B
     409640  322289624      2  GPT part - 7C3457EF-0000-11AA-AA11-00306543ECAC
  322699264  165778528      3  GPT part - EBD0A0A2-B9E5-4433-87C0-68B6B72699C7
  488477792        928         
  488478720    1753088      4  GPT part - DE94BBA4-06D1-4D40-A16A-BFD50179D6AC
  490231808       2911         
  490234719         32         Sec GPT table
  490234751          1         Sec GPT header
Ricks-MacBook-Pro:~ rickmaxxx$ sudo fdisk /dev/disk0
Disk: /dev/disk0    geometry: 30515/255/63 [490234752 sectors]
Signature: 0xAA55
         Starting       Ending
 #: id  cyl  hd sec -  cyl  hd sec [     start -       size]
------------------------------------------------------------------------
 1: EE 1023 254  63 - 1023 254  63 [         1 -  490234751] <Unknown ID>
 2: 00    0   0   0 -    0   0   0 [         0 -          0] unused      
 3: 00    0   0   0 -    0   0   0 [         0 -          0] unused      
 4: 00    0   0   0 -    0   0   0 [         0 -          0] unused      
Ricks-MacBook-Pro:~ rickmaxxx$ 

После r

Ricks-MacBook-Pro:~ rickmaxxx$ di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*251.0 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                 Apple_APFS Container disk1         165.0 GB   disk0s2
   3:       Microsoft Basic Data BOOTCAMP                84.9 GB    disk0s3
   4:           Windows Recovery                         897.6 MB   disk0s4

/dev/disk1 (synthesized):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      APFS Container Scheme -                      +165.0 GB   disk1
                                 Physical Store disk0s2
   1:                APFS Volume Macintosh HD            90.9 GB    disk1s1
   2:                APFS Volume Preboot                 46.6 MB    disk1s2
   3:                APFS Volume Recovery                510.5 MB   disk1s3
   4:                APFS Volume VM                      1.1 GB     disk1s4

Ricks-MacBook-Pro:~ rickmaxxx$ sudo gpt -r show /dev/disk0
Password:
gpt show: /dev/disk0: Suspicious MBR at sector 0
      start       size  index  contents
          0          1         MBR
          1          1         Pri GPT header
          2         32         Pri GPT table
         34          6         
         40     409600      1  GPT part - C12A7328-F81F-11D2-BA4B-00A0C93EC93B
     409640  322289624      2  GPT part - 7C3457EF-0000-11AA-AA11-00306543ECAC
  322699264  165778528      3  GPT part - EBD0A0A2-B9E5-4433-87C0-68B6B72699C7
  488477792        928         
  488478720    1753088      4  GPT part - DE94BBA4-06D1-4D40-A16A-BFD50179D6AC
  490231808       2911         
  490234719         32         Sec GPT table
  490234751          1         Sec GPT header

Ricks-MacBook-Pro:~ rickmaxxx$ sudo fdisk /dev/disk0
Disk: /dev/disk0    geometry: 30515/255/63 [490234752 sectors]
Signature: 0xAA55
         Starting       Ending
 #: id  cyl  hd sec -  cyl  hd sec [     start -       size]
------------------------------------------------------------------------
 1: EE    0   0   1 - 1023 254  63 [         1 -     409639] <Unknown ID>
*2: DA 1023 254  63 - 1023 254  63 [    409640 -  322289624] <Unknown ID>
 3: 07 1023 254  63 - 1023 254  63 [ 322699264 -  165778528] HPFS/QNX/AUX
 4: 07 1023 254  63 - 1023 254  63 [ 488478720 -    1753088] HPFS/QNX/AUX
Ricks-MacBook-Pro:~ rickmaxxx$ 

Обратите внимание на сообщение «gpt show: / dev / disk0: Suspicious MB R at secto r 0»

Итак, главное r последствие всего этого в том, что я могу нет лонга r загрузиться в Windows (Bootcamp). У меня только темный экран. Система MacOS, похоже, работает нормально, но раньше secto r 0 был PMB R, а теперь - MB R. Prio r к этому Я успешно установил rEFInd и был вполне доволен результатами, думая, что Linux Ubuntu с радостью будет работать вместе с ним, что позволит мне выполнить тройную загрузку.

Howeve r, когда я запустите мой MacBook Pro с установленным USB-накопителем Fla sh, он переходит непосредственно в Ubuntu без появления rEFInd. Все в Ubuntu работает должным образом.

В качестве альтернативы, когда я запускаю свой MacBook Pro, удерживая клавишу «option» для выбора Ubuntu, я получаю следующее сообщение crypti c:

APFSStart:1555: Mounting with apfs_efi_osx-945.275.9
efi_fusion_pairing:668: Container 06a8e9fd-ae73-4c94-92de-a80e6c2e6099
efi_fusion_pairing:673: fusion uuid: 00000000-0000-0000-0000-000000000000
efi_container_create:972: Volume attached is internal
nx_kernel_mount:1473: : checkpoint search: largest xid 790302, best xid 790302 @ 135
er_state_obj_get_for_recovery:4214: No ER state object for volume Preboot
- rolling is not happening, nothing to recover.
er_state_obj_get_for_recovery:4214: No ER state object for volume Recovery
- rolling is not happening, nothing to recover.
er_state_obj_get_for_recovery:4214: No ER state object for volume VM 
- rolling is not happening, nothing to recover.
System BootOrder not found.  Initializing defaults.

Когда я загружаюсь в MacOS и открываю Дисковую утилиту, чтобы посмотреть на Bootcamp, все, кажется, все еще там, но я не уверен, что мне нужно исправить, чтобы получить доступ. Я начну изучать r все статьи, связанные с загрузкой r, но если у кого-то есть идеи, мы будем очень признательны. В крайнем случае, я попытаюсь восстановить r с помощью Carbon Copy Clone r, но я не уверен, что это вернет мою последовательность загрузочной загрузки r. Заранее благодарим за r любые предложения.

1 Ответ

2 голосов
/ 21 июля 2020

Мне удалось успешно загрузиться в свой раздел Windows (Bootcamp) после загрузки r и следования этим инструкциям, предоставленным Rod Smith в SuperUse r: Как исправить гибрид MB R с помощью дисковой утилиты

Это гибридный MB R. Необходимо загрузить Windows в режиме B IOS, но если вы планируете установить Windows 8 o r 10 в режиме EFI, вам необходимо заменить гибридный MB R на законный защитный MB R. Вы можете сделать это с помощью моей GPT fdisk (gdisk) программы:

  1. Запустить gdisk на диске (sudo gdisk /dev/disk0 в вашем r случае).
  2. Введите x, чтобы войти в r режим экспертов.
  3. Введите n, чтобы создать новый защитный MB R.
  4. Введите 'w` для сохранения вы r изменений.
  5. Введите y, чтобы подтвердить, что вы хотите сохранить изменения.

Я также сделал небольшое пожертвование его сайту в знак признательности за r обширные технические знания, которые он передает сообществу Ubuntu. Руководство по GPT fdisk

...